Hi,

In order to view the java applets, you need to enable the ActiveX controls.
I suggest you go through the following steps, to do so:

1. Open Internet Explorer.
2. Click Tools, Internet Explorer.
3. Click Security tab.
4. Click Custom level tab.
5. Select the Enable option for the following:

Initialize and script ActiveX controls not marked as safe
Run ActiveX controls and plug-ins
Script ActiveX controls marked safe for scripting.

6. Click OK.
7. Click OK.
8. Close Internet Explorer and again open.

Now you can view the applets.
